DESCRIPTION TEMD5110X01 is a high speed and high sensitive PIN photodiode miniature surface mount device (SMD) 2 including the chip with a 7.5 mm daylight blocking filter matched with IR emitters operating at wavelength 870 nm or 950 nm.
